-The Herfindahl-Hirschman Index is used as a guideline to determine if a market is competitive or concentrated. Calculate the index value for each market described below.
a) 100 firms, each of which produces 1 per cent of market output
b) 50 firms, each of which produces 2 per cent of market output
c) 25 firms, each of which produces 4 per cent of market output
d) 20 firms, each of which produces 5 per cent of market output
e) 10 firms, each of which produces 10 per cent of market output
f) 5 firms, each of which produces 20 per cent of market output
g) 2 firms, each of which produces 50 per cent of market output
